Four Held For Attacking Fast-Food Center Workers
Hyderabad, Feb 6 (Maxim News): The Jawaharnagar police arrested four persons who had allegedly attacked workers of a fast food center when they later refused to provide them with steel plates.
The four persons Aakash, Vivek, Kalyan, and Amul Raj had gone to a fast food center at Yapral road for food. According to the Jawahar Nagar Police, after purchasing food, they demanded the workers give plates to them instead of disposable plates.
When their demand for steel plates was refused, they attacked hotel workers Vivek, Soya, and also the owner. “A case was registered and all of them were taken into custody after identifying them with the help of closed circuit camera network feed said Jawaharnagar Inspector K.Chandrasekhar.
